A high-powered delegation led by representatives of the First Lady of Nigeria, Sen. Oluremi Tinubu, has paid a condolence visit to Governor Ahmed Ododo of Kogi, following the passing of his father, Alh. Ahmed Momohsani.
The governor’s father passed away on Aug . 18, and laid to rest on Aug. 19 according to Islamic rites.
The delegation, led by Hajiya Laila Barau, wife of the Deputy Senate President, expressed heartfelt sympathy to the governor, his family, and the people of Kogi State.
The delegation, which included First Ladies of several States, wives of serving Ministers, and top officials of the federal government, offered prayers for the repose of Alhaji Ododo’s soul.
Hajiya Barau conveyed first lady’s condolences, describing Alhaji Ododo’s demise as saddening but noting that he lived a worthy and fulfilled life, leaving behind a great legacy.
The delegation prayed for Almighty Allah to forgive his shortcomings and grant him Aljannah Firdaus.
The Special Adviser on Women Affairs, Hajiya Nana Abdullahi, expressed profound appreciation to the First Lady and her representatives for their presence, prayers, and condolence messages.
She noted that the gesture has brought immense comfort to the family in their moment of grief.
Among the delegation were wives of the Governors of Yobe and Ebonyi states; wives of the Ministers works, Agriculture and Food Security, Minister of State for Agriculture and Food Security, Minister of Defence. Minister of Budget and National Planning; as well as top officials be of the Kogi State government.
